Chelsea Handler is not happy that Instagram removed a topless photo she posted of herself.
The image features Handler riding horseback without a shirt spliced next to a famous photo of Russian President Vladimir Putin doing the same thing. Handler captioned the picture: “Anything a man can do, a woman has the right to do better #kremlin.” When Instagram took the image down, she put it back up and called the policy sexist (Instagram removed it again).
“Taking this down is sexist,” the comedian wrote in re-posting the image on her Twitter feed. “I have every right to show I have a better body than Putin.”
Handler also posted Instagram’s notice to her that it had removed the picture.
